Ampverse DMI’s ‘College Rivals’ Tournament Revs Up Mumbai’s Esports Scene

In the bustling metropolis of Mumbai, a thrilling wave of gaming fervor is on the rise. Ampverse DMI, a leading light in the esports industry, has rolled out its much-anticipated ‘College Rivals‘ tournament in the city of dreams. This exciting event, already a hot topic among gamers nationwide, is set to spark an esports revolution across Mumbai’s top colleges.

College Rivals Arrives in Mumbai, Unleashing Esports in the City of Dreams

The iconic College Rivals truck, a beacon for gaming enthusiasts, is making its rounds of the city’s premier educational institutions, including HR College, Jai Hind College, Terna College, KJ Somaiya, and DY Patil College. The tournament has already garnered widespread acclaim and support from students and colleges in Delhi, Hyderabad, Bengaluru and Pune, marking its success in fostering a vibrant esports culture.

At the core of College Rivals‘ mission is the nurturing of esports talent. The tournament actively engages with India’s thriving gaming community, having covered over 9200 kilometers and interacted with more than 73,000 students. Now, as the truck rolls into Mumbai, it continues its quest to discover India’s most promising gaming talent.

Mumbai is gearing up for an immersive esports experience. From engaging interactions with leading gamers to dynamic live DJ performances, the city is set to plunge into the passion-filled world of esports. Adding to the excitement, Mortal, one of India’s most celebrated esports players, will grace the event.

Ampverse’s unique approach to College Rivals reflects its commitment to India’s dynamic gaming culture. By bringing the tournament to Mumbai, Ampverse is not only engaging with the city’s gaming community but also inching closer to the grand finale of the tournament, which is slated to take place in Mumbai itself.

Having successfully traversed India’s major cities, Ampverse is well on its way to transforming the country’s esports landscape.

Ashwin Haryani, Country Head – India at Ampverse, shares his enthusiasm, “Launching College Rivals in Mumbai is a significant milestone in our ongoing mission to empower India’s vibrant gaming community. The incredible response we’ve seen in cities like Delhi, Hyderabad, Bengaluru, and Pune has fueled our motivation. As we step into Mumbai, we’re eager to elevate the gaming spirit even further. We’re thrilled to reach the final city on this exciting journey and anticipate breaking new ground in the realm of competitive gaming.”
